The Opportunity

Amentum is the Design and Engineering partner for Sellafield under the PPP (Programme and Project Partners). This is a 20-year arrangement to deliver ~£7bn of major projects. We are looking to recruit high value expertise from across regulated and comparable sectors to work in a collaborative environment. PPP is delivering major projects, site wide improvements and provision of supporting services.

The Role

As a Senior EC&I Engineer your responsibilities will include:

* Leading EC&I design activities across multiple project phases including detailed design, procurement, manufacture, installation, and commissioning.

* Managing and developing the EC&I design configuration baseline in response to evolving project requirements, ensuring robust change control.

* Producing, reviewing, and approving EC&I design deliverables to programme deadlines and ensuring compliance with all relevant standards, codes, legislation, and client engineering requirements.

* Providing technical oversight of the EC&I supply chain, including resolution of complex Technical Queries, design assurance reviews, approval of supplier deliverables, and support to Factory Acceptance Testing and Site Acceptance Testing.

* Coordinating EC&I system integration with multidisciplinary engineering teams through BIM, interface management and formal design reviews.

* Supporting development of junior engineers and providing technical guidance across the EC&I discipline.

* Ensuring the EC&I design intent is fully aligned with nuclear and conventional safety requirements, and that all functional, performance, and safety-critical requirements are met through appropriate Validation and Verification processes.

* Contributing to project planning, risk assessments, design substantiation, and assurance activities.

As a Senior EC&I Engineer you will have;

* BEng/MEng degree in a relevant discipline, or demonstrable equivalent experience with an HNC/HND. - Chartered or Incorporated Engineer status (or working towards chartership).

* Significant experience delivering EC&I design within complex, highly regulated industries; nuclear sector experience is highly desirable.

* Demonstrable technical responsibility in producing and validating EC&I design deliverables and substantiation documents.

* Strong understanding of relevant UK legislation, design codes, and industry good practice for EC&I engineering.

* Proficiency with relevant CAE and modelling tools (e.g., Autodesk AutoCAD, BIM/3D modelling platforms). - Proven ability to mentor junior engineers and contribute to competency development within the discipline
